The Electrical System Design and Grid Integration department is looking for the services of a consultant to help with the development of a number of electrical design for offshore wind farms at the concept design stage of the project. The role will require the consultant to propose initial designs and then develop the designs using risk based assessment techniques to produce concept designs that can be used for bid submission and as the basis of more detailed design if the bid is successful. The consultant will be required to work on a number of project concurrently.
The consultant will be a key member of the electrical design team and will need to work flexibly as the priorities of projects move as work progresses. The consultant will need to be comfortable working with reasonably high levels of uncertainty and be able to work at a senior level within the team requiring only high level supervision. The key product that the consultant will be delivering within the team for each of the projects will be a single line diagram (SLD) and a concept design report, together with an assumption book and risk book appropriate for the electrical design for each of the projects.
